Rangers goalkeeper Allan McGregor will be left red-faced as footage has emerged of him from their game at the weekend.

Rangers managed to maintain their challenge for the title this weekend as they ran out 2-1 winners away from home, but they were certainly made to work hard for it.

They had to come from behind thanks to goals from Aaron Ramsey and a late winner from Connor Goldson to ensure that they stayed within touching distance at the top of the table as we head towards the business end of the season.

However, they wouldn’t have had to come from behind at all were it not for the effort, or perhaps lack thereof, from goalkeeper McGregor for Dundee’s opening goal.

In the early stages of the game (via @ScotlandSky), Dundee’s Jordan Marshall managed to get in a cross from the byline and the ball was headed in at the back post by Christie Elliot, with McGregor in the Rangers net just standing there and letting it sail over his head when he could arguably have made a better attempt to pluck it out of the air.

Despite being Rangers’ No 1 for large parts of the season, racking up 37 appearances, McGregor’s spot at the club next year is far from secure.

He is out of contract at the end of the season, and at his age, it would be very easy for the club to simply move him on, even if former Rangers man Ally McCoist thinks that he might have another year left in him. And moments like this could end up playing a big part in the club’s decision of whether or not they want to keep him.

Whilst it didn’t make a big difference as they still came away with the win, with the table in the state that it is, goal difference could very well play a part in how the title race ends up playing out, and giving away cheap goals like this could end up having a major impact for Rangers as they look to close the gap.
